Filipino-Kiwi guard Richie Rodger signs one-year extension with the NLEX Road Warriors

The NLEX Road Warriors have reaffirmed their faith in Richie Rodger, signing the Filipino-New Zealand guard to a one-year contract extension during the 2025 Kadayawan Invitational Basketball Tournament in Davao.

 

Present at the signing were team governor Ronald Dulatre, team manager Virgil Villavicencio, and Rodger’s agent Marvin Espiritu of Espiritu Manotoc Basketball Management.

 

“I’m very happy to remain with NLEX. I think we are building something special here, and I’m thrilled to be a part of it,” Rodger said.

The 28-year-old guard earned the extension despite missing most of Season 49 of the PBA Philippine Cup due to appendicitis. He suited up in just four games, with his last appearance coming on May 7 against Barangay Ginebra San Miguel, where he tallied two points and three assists in 14 minutes before being sidelined.

 

Rodger admitted the setback was frustrating but said he is now fully recovered and eager to make up for lost time.

 

“After missing most of our last conference with appendicitis, I’m excited to be back with the team after seeing how well we played getting to the quarterfinals,” he said. “It was unfortunate that we fell short despite the twice-to-beat advantage, but that serves as motivation for us heading into Season 50.

 

“I’m really looking forward to being back on the court and contributing to help us take the next step.”

 

NLEX reached the Philippine Cup quarterfinals last season but failed to advance to the semifinals despite owning a twice-to-beat edge.
